Graffiti, Murals & Urban Art

Spent yesterday with Karla and Francesca, exploring the Mission in San Francisco.  We have been to the Franklin Square area many times to pick up fabric, gear and work events.  This time we went to explore, see the various murals and of course do a mini photo shoot with France.

Found a great retaining wall piece (while chasing after France) that had lots of little details and textures.  You can find it on Florida St. just past Coffee Bar and right before 17th.

The Calumet Mural by Sirron Norris is an instant eye catcher, spanning both street sides of the camera shop.  You could easily spend all afternoon taking in this mural.
